驾驭复杂数据:SEM结构方程模型的前沿突破与实践创新164


亲爱的知识探索者们,大家好!我是你们的老朋友,专注于数据分析与量化研究的知识博主。今天,我们要深入探讨的,是量化研究领域的一颗璀璨明珠——结构方程模型(Structural Equation Modeling, SEM)。它不仅是连接理论与实证的桥梁,更是帮助我们理解复杂社会现象背后深层机制的强大工具。然而,科学研究永无止境,SEM也一直在不断演进和创新。今天,我就带大家一起,揭秘SEM的最新研究进展、方法突破以及在实践中的创新应用。

在社会科学、行为科学、管理学、教育学乃至医学等诸多领域,SEM因其能够同时处理潜变量、测量误差、复杂的因果关系网络而备受青睐。传统SEM基于协方差结构分析,通过构建测量模型(确认性因子分析)和结构模型(路径分析),来检验理论模型与观测数据之间的拟合程度。然而,随着数据科学的飞速发展、研究问题的日益复杂,以及对因果推断严谨性的更高要求,SEM的研究前沿也在不断拓展。

一、 方法论的革新:SEM如何变得更强大、更灵活?

传统的SEM虽然功能强大,但在面对特定数据类型或研究问题时,仍存在一些局限。近年来,一系列方法论的创新,正逐步打破这些限制,让SEM的应用场景更加广阔。

1. 贝叶斯结构方程模型(Bayesian SEM, BSEM):

这是当前SEM领域最热门的研究方向之一。与传统频数主义SEM依赖大样本渐近理论不同,BSEM通过结合先验信息和数据信息,对模型参数进行后验推断。它的优势显而易见:
小样本问题: 在样本量有限的情况下,BSEM的表现通常优于传统SEM,尤其是在参数估计的稳定性和准确性方面。
先验知识整合: 研究者可以根据已有的理论或过往研究结果,设定参数的先验分布,这使得模型估计更具信息性,尤其是在模型识别困难或参数估计不稳定的情况下。
处理复杂模型: 对于一些传统SEM难以处理的复杂模型,如多层模型、混合模型等,BSEM能够提供更稳健的估计。
不确定性量化: BSEM直接给出参数的后验分布,可以更直观地理解参数的不确定性。

BSEM的兴起,无疑为研究者们提供了更灵活、更具韧性的建模选择,尤其是在那些难以获得大规模样本的领域(如临床心理学、小众市场研究)中,BSEM正成为越来越重要的工具。

2. 动态结构方程模型(Dynamic SEM, DSEM):

传统的SEM多用于截面数据或少量时间点数据的分析,难以有效捕捉变量在个体内部随时间变化的动态过程。DSEM应运而生,它将时间序列分析与SEM相结合,允许研究者同时建模个体内部(within-person)的动态变化和个体之间(between-person)的差异。这对于心理学(如情绪波动、干预效果)、管理学(如团队动态、领导力演变)等关注过程性变量的学科具有里程碑式的意义。DSEM使得我们能够回答“一个人的情绪是如何随时间变化的,以及这种变化是否会影响其工作表现”这类更具洞察力的问题。

3. 机器学习与SEM的融合:

机器学习(ML)以其强大的预测能力和模式识别能力,在数据科学领域独领风骚。而SEM则以其对理论假设的检验和因果路径的解释见长。将两者结合,正成为一个新的研究热点。例如:
特征选择: 利用ML算法(如Lasso回归)帮助SEM在复杂数据中筛选出最重要的观测变量,以简化模型并提高解释力。
预测性SEM: 传统SEM更侧重解释,而ML-SEM则尝试在保证理论解释的基础上,增强模型的预测能力,例如通过交叉验证等技术评估模型的泛化性能。
混合模型: 将SEM的理论驱动与ML的数据驱动相结合,构建更复杂的混合模型,以处理非线性关系、交互作用等复杂情况。

这种融合,有望弥补SEM在处理非线性、高维数据方面的不足,同时也为机器学习模型提供更深层的理论解释框架。

4. 非参数与半参数SEM:

传统SEM通常假设变量服从多元正态分布,并要求测量尺度达到区间水平。当这些假设被违反时,模型的估计结果可能出现偏差。非参数或半参数SEM旨在放宽这些假设,例如利用分位数回归、核函数估计等方法,在不对数据分布做强假设的情况下进行模型估计。这使得SEM能够处理更多样化的数据类型,如序数数据、偏态分布数据等,从而提高了模型的稳健性和适用性。

二、 复杂数据结构的驾驭:SEM的进阶应用

现实世界的数据往往不是简单线性的,它们可能具有层级结构、时间依赖性,甚至存在未知的亚群。SEM的最新研究也在积极应对这些复杂性。

1. 多层结构方程模型(Multilevel SEM, ML-SEM):

当数据具有嵌套结构时(例如,学生嵌套在班级中,班级嵌套在学校中),独立性假设被违反,传统SEM会给出偏误的估计结果。ML-SEM能够同时估计不同层级上的关系,区分个体层面的效应和群体层面的效应,从而更准确地反映数据的真实结构。这在教育学、组织行为学等领域,是进行严谨研究不可或缺的工具。

2. 混合模型(Mixture Models)与潜类别分析(Latent Class Analysis, LCA):

很多时候,一个样本群体并非同质的,而是由若干个未被观测到的亚群组成。混合模型(包括LCA和潜类别增长模型LCTA等)能够帮助研究者识别这些潜在的异质性亚群,并分析不同亚群之间的差异。例如,在消费者行为研究中,可以识别出对某一产品有不同偏好的潜在消费者群体;在教育研究中,可以发现具有不同学习轨迹的潜在学生群体。将混合模型与SEM结合,可以更深入地探索不同亚群内部的结构关系。

3. 大数据与高维数据下的SEM:

随着“大数据”时代的到来,研究者常常面临海量数据和高维变量的挑战。如何在这种背景下有效运行SEM,并保证模型的稳定性和可解释性,是当前SEM研究的重要方向。一些策略包括:利用维度约减技术(如主成分分析、因子分析)预处理数据,开发更高效的计算算法,以及结合ML技术处理高维特征。

三、 因果推断的深化:SEM如何更好地揭示“为什么”?

SEM的一个核心优势在于其能够检验复杂的因果关系假设。然而,传统的SEM在因果推断的严谨性上仍有提升空间。最新的研究正在努力使其更接近“真正的”因果推断。

1. 基于反事实框架的因果SEM:

将SEM与潜在结果(potential outcomes)框架(即鲁宾因果模型)结合,使得研究者能够更清晰地界定因果效应,并利用工具变量、倾向性得分匹配等技术,在SEM框架内处理内生性问题,从而提升因果推断的可靠性。

2. 纵向数据与因果:

利用交叉滞后模型、潜增长模型等纵向SEM方法,可以更好地揭示变量随时间变化的因果顺序。例如,分析“是学业压力导致了焦虑,还是焦虑导致了学业压力,亦或是两者互为因果?”这类问题。

3. 复杂中介与调节模型的拓展:

中介和调节效应一直是SEM的强项。最新的研究不仅在理论上拓展了中介和调节的类型(如链式中介、被调节的中介),还在统计方法上提供了更精确的估计和检验方法(如偏差校正的非参数Bootstrap法),确保对这些复杂效应的准确解读。

四、 计算工具与最佳实践:让研究更高效、更规范

方法论的进步离不开强大的计算工具支持。R语言中的`lavaan`、`blavaan`、`MplusAutomation`以及`OpenMx`等包,提供了高度灵活且开源的SEM建模环境,极大地降低了前沿方法的使用门槛。Mplus软件则以其强大的功能和对各种复杂模型(如DSEM、ML-SEM、混合模型)的良好支持而受到广泛欢迎。此外,研究者们也越来越强调SEM研究的透明度、可重复性和结果报告的规范性,例如鼓励使用开放数据、开放代码,并严格遵守报告标准,以提升整个研究领域的公信力。

五、 挑战与展望

尽管SEM的研究取得了显著进展,但挑战依然存在。例如,如何在大数据背景下平衡模型的解释力与计算效率;如何更好地处理非线性和复杂交互作用;以及如何进一步提升SEM在因果推断方面的严谨性。未来,SEM的发展将可能更加强调跨学科融合,与人工智能、网络科学、复杂系统理论等领域碰撞出新的火花。同时,将更复杂的理论模型与实际应用场景紧密结合,为解决现实世界的问题提供更精准的洞察,也将是SEM持续发力的方向。

结构方程模型并非一成不变的“黑箱”,它是一个充满活力、不断进化的领域。作为研究者,我们应始终保持好奇心和学习的热情,拥抱这些前沿突破,并将其巧妙地应用于我们的研究实践中。通过不断学习和探索,我们将能更好地驾驭复杂数据,洞察现象背后的深层机制,为构建更美好的世界贡献我们的智慧。希望今天的分享能为大家带来启发,让我们在SEM的探索之路上,携手前行!

2026-04-18


上一篇:掘金沧州数字营销:SEM人才的崛起与职业发展全攻略

下一篇:解密结构方程模型:‘测SEM不能‘的误解与真相